Output ec4bf937412ae018fa4e0da58fbd7e716e08737d4e7d5a79b51459c666a28ca8:0

value
1594810
script pubkey
OP_HASH160 OP_PUSHBYTES_20 136dc1331681d71719ac56f0876f00294f5310a8 OP_EQUAL
address
33TkF5TwfkRkyDA3MZgdLeMSj4EdAa9v3P
transaction
ec4bf937412ae018fa4e0da58fbd7e716e08737d4e7d5a79b51459c666a28ca8
confirmations
147837
spent
true